#dea18e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dea18e is composed of 87.1% red, 63.1%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.5% magenta, 36%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 14.3 degrees, a saturation of 54.8% and a lightness of 71.4%. #dea18e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bd431d.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#dea18e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dea18e has RGB values of R:222, G:161,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.36,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14590350.
